Infrastructure refers to the systems, facilities, and networks that enable a society and its economy to function smoothly. It includes both physical structures like highways, bridges, power grids, and water supply systems, as well as social and digital systems such as schools, hospitals, and communication networks.
Well-planned infrastructure ensures:
Smooth movement of people and goods
Access to clean water, energy, and healthcare
Reliable communication and digital connectivity
Economic productivity and sustainable growth
Infrastructure is generally divided into six major categories, each playing a critical role in daily life and economic development.
Examples: Roads, highways, bridges, ports, airports, and railways
Why it matters: Reduces travel time, boosts trade, and connects communities.
Case Study: India’s Golden Quadrilateral Highway reduced travel time between metros by 25–30%, cutting logistics costs and improving trade efficiency.

Infrastructure impacts every citizen, every business, and every government decision. Its importance includes:
Improving Quality of Life: Clean water, electricity, healthcare, and education.
Supporting Economic Growth: Efficient logistics reduce costs and increase productivity.
Creating Jobs: Infrastructure projects employ millions across construction, technology, and services.
Enabling Digital Access: Telecom and internet networks connect communities globally.
Enhancing Safety & Sustainability: Planned infrastructure reduces accidents and environmental damage.
